Henry Burneson was a lot like me. As a junior at Yorktown High School, he played high school sports, spent much of his free time giving back to the community, and was a food fanatic. Things could not have been going better for him. However, one morning, he woke up and began experiencing intense pain in his legs. Within days, he was diagnosed with Acute Lymphoblastic Leukemia, the most common form of childhood cancer. Despite a survival rate of around 90%, he passed away on October 16, 2015 after battling Leukemia for nine months.

Although I never knew him personally, the impact he left on students, teachers, and the Yorktown community still resonates today. My freshman year English teacher had Henry as a student a few years earlier and placed a portrait of him in her room to honor the bright, courageous student he was. Everyday, I walked into my English classroom and glanced up at Henry above the whiteboard. And everyday I wished I could have helped him.

Because of campaigns like Students of the Year, LLS has seen tremendous success discovering new and more effective treatments for blood cancer patients and has created a new exciting initiative focusing on treatments for pediatric patients. In addition, many LLS supported therapies not only help blood cancer patients but are now used to treat patients with rare forms of stomach and skin cancers. They're even being tested in clinical trials for patients with a range of cancers including lung, brain, breast, pancreatic and prostate cancers. LLS funded drugs are now being tested for patients with other non-cancerous diseases like Diabetes, Rheumatoid Arthritis and Multiple Sclerosis.
